Health Savings Accounts (HSAs) are a great way to save for medical expenses tax-free. But when it comes time to access those funds, you may wonder how to do so. Here are some ways to take out HSA money:
You can pay for eligible medical expenses out of pocket and then request a reimbursement from your HSA. Keep all receipts and documentation.
Many HSA providers issue a debit card linked to your account for easy and immediate access to funds when paying for medical expenses.
You can usually transfer funds from your HSA to your checking account online through the provider's website or mobile app.
Some HSA providers offer check-writing capabilities, allowing you to write a check directly from your HSA to pay for medical expenses.
It's essential to keep in mind that you should only use HSA funds for qualified medical expenses to avoid tax penalties. Consult with a tax professional or financial advisor if you have questions about eligible expenses.
